PARLIAMENTARY EARLY DAY MOTION
GIBRALTAR AND SELF-DETERMINATION (4 March 2003)

Motion Details

That this House welcomes the United Nations statement of 12th February which stresses the importance of self-determination for territorial peoples; notes that despite the referendum in Gibraltar in November 2002 which revealed that 99 per cent. of Gibraltarians wish to remain British, there has been no categorical assurance by Her Majesty's Government that the freely expressed will of the people of Gibraltar will be observed; further notes that the United Nations believes that integration for territories should be an option; and calls on Her Majesty's Government ot offer the Gibraltarian people the option of integration with the United Kingdom.
